The La Jolla Cosmetic Podcast seeks to demystify cosmetic surgery. More and more Americans undergo such procedures each year. Yet it is a subject few discuss in public. This show wants to change that.

Podcast host Monique Ramsey is the Chief Creative Officer at the La Jolla Cosmetic Surgery Centre & Medical Spa. La Jolla does a variety of plastic surgery procedures. These include invasive and non-invasive measures. The La Jolla Cosmetic Podcast talks about how these procedures can change lives.

Ramsey interviews patients, employees, and experts about cosmetic surgery procedures. Is a Brazilian butt lift dangerous? Is getting breast implants at age 57 too late? What is a mommy makeover? These are some of the many cosmetic surgery topics discussed. Real-life patients like Laura Cain, a radio host, talk about getting breast augmentation. Listeners hear her thoughts before and after the surgery, and whether it was worth it. The La Jolla Cosmetic Podcast has respectful talks about these topics.

Listeners will also hear about cosmetic surgery procedures like CoolSculpting and lip fillers. Rhinoplasty (also called a nose job) gets explained in several episodes. The episode pages show pictures of the work done, so listeners can see what the subjects look like now.

The podcast has a Meet the Team feature. Staff members and physicians explain what they do and how it improves people's lives. And one episode talks about a woman who got emergency surgery on her face after a fall in the desert. Other episodes talk about breast implant removal and breast reduction surgery. The show also discusses what patients can do now to look and feel younger.

The La Jolla Cosmetic Podcast explains so much about cosmetic surgery. Those considering getting a procedure may want to listen to this podcast.

Mommy Makeover Explained by a Plastic Surgeon (and Mom)
Jan 11 2024
Mommy Makeover Explained by a Plastic Surgeon (and Mom)
Yes, motherhood is beautiful. But bringing children into the world wreaks some havoc on the body!A mommy makeover is a combination of procedures designed to address areas that need lifting and tightening after having children.Plastic surgeon (and mom) Dr. Diana Breister Ghosh shares the advantages of combining body restoration procedures into one surgery.
